OverviewWe are used to seeing the world as a globe. But distances along curved surfaces are not easy to visualise, and navigation between two places on the globe is not just a case of drawing a straight line. So how does it work? This book provides a unique way to make a globe through 12 Tile Maps, maps that take sections of the world and make them flat but carefully connected. Using tools provided readers can answer the quizzes about the shortest routes between cities for their airline and explore the geography of the world as they do it. Minimal craftwork is required to get excellent results.
